A 'forced marriage fanfic' is a type of fan - created fictional story. It often involves characters being forced into a marriage situation, usually within the context of a pre - existing fictional universe, like a TV show, movie, or book series. For example, in some fanfics based on fantasy series, two characters from different kingdoms might be forced to marry for political reasons.
Love and longing are also common. Even in a forced marriage situation, the characters may long for true love. They might be in love with someone else before the forced marriage or might develop feelings for someone new later. Social hierarchy is another theme. Often, forced marriages are arranged according to the social status of the families involved, and this can create a lot of tension and drama in the story.
